Name: Black Rune Sword
Appearance: A very large and heavy greatsword that is about 5 feet long, 3 feet in length and weighs around 500lbs. The entire sword is made of various mineral elements, the blade being made from a mixture of crystals and iron, the hilt from black stones and the runes being carved from the same type of Crystal Elysant is made from as well as being green in color.
Enchantment: As the blade and Elysant are made from the same Crystal (albeit the crystals are infused with arcane magic), the two are connected. The blade cannot go any further away than 5 feet before the blade will reappear draped across her back.
Limits: The blade will only reappear if it goes outside the 5 feet radius. If one were to keep it within the radius while outside of her reach, the blade will never respawn until she is at least five feet away from it.
